You may be suffering from a corneal abrasion if you feel like you have sand or grit in your eyes, notice tearing and redness, become sensitive to light, or have pain when you open or close your eyes. Typically, corneal abrasions heal themself within a couple of days, but if you are still experiencing pain after that, we recommend getting it checked by a doctor!

Did you know that many people begin developing cataracts around the age of 40?! However, most people won’t notice any symptoms of cataracts until after the age of 60. Thankfully, cataract removal is a very common and safe procedure!

Children born with ptosis have what is called congenital ptosis. This can be caused by problems with the muscle that lifts the eyelid. A child with ptosis may tip their head back, lift up their chin, or raise their eyebrows to try to see better. Over time, these movements can cause head and neck problems. During cataract surgery, the clouded lens of the eye is removed and replaced with an artificial lens, known as an intraocular lens or “IOL”. To learn more about IOLs, please visit our website.
